The table below looks at the prevalence of the term Banking in permanent job vacancies in the Midlands. Included is a benchmarking guide to the salaries offered in vacancies that cited Banking over the 6 months leading up to 26 July 2024, comparing them to the same period in the previous two years.

6 months to
26 Jul 2024
Same period 2023 Same period 2022
Rank 194 98 215
Rank change year-on-year -96 +117 +21
Permanent jobs citing Banking 118 229 173
As % of all permanent jobs advertised in the Midlands 1.02% 3.02% 1.40%
As % of the General category 1.88% 4.31% 2.09%
Number of salaries quoted 45 51 138
10th Percentile £28,500 £41,250 £32,500
25th Percentile £31,250 £50,750 £45,438
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£60,000 £60,000 £57,500
Median % change year-on-year - +4.35% +7.48%
75th Percentile £76,250 £68,125 £77,500
90th Percentile £80,000 £106,289 £100,000
England median annual salary £90,000 £75,554 £75,000
% change year-on-year +19.12% +0.74% -3.23%
